I am gluten intolerant. I went for dinner on a Saturday, that always makes me nervous. The reviews were good and Stewby's did not disappoint! There was an order and a pickup window, and a small printed sign alerted me the young woman taking my order was in training. I asked for the gluten free menu, she looked at me funny and another woman whipped around and said with a smile, "Tell me what you want to order." Then she asked if I was celiac or intolerant! And with that and the order went in, the expeditor was alerted and the kitchen notified! My sea scallops were seasoned and grilled to perfection, the cheese grits thick, and the potato salad had a nice crunch of pickles. I waited 24 hours to write this just to make sure it was as good as I hoped! Not one symptom! Five stars for Stewby's!

This is the best place for seafood! their grilled fish and shrimp are out of this world! They do have a gluten-free menu and are knowledgeable about GF. Their fries are fried with their hush puppies (only) and I am super sensitive and have never gotten sick from the fries. I am celiac. Spoke with the owner about expanding their GF menu to include fried items using rice flour which he seemed very amenable to. He says they don't get too many requests so if you go there to eat, tell them you read it on this app and would love for them to add fried foods to their GF menu! I told him about this app and said if it was listed, people would come! Also ask if their hush puppies can be made GF. GREAT food and business is booming. Destin seafood at Fort Walton prices!!
